Dr. H. K. Sharma

Professor, Department of Pharmaceutical Sciences

Profile

Education:

  1. Bachelor’s Degree: B. Pharm.; Dibrugarh University
  2. Master’s Degree: M. Pharm. (Pharmaceutics); Jadavpur University
  3. Ph.D.: Pharmaceutical Sciences; Dibrugarh University

Professional Experience:    

  •  Teaching and Research  experience: Since 1997

Areas of Interest/ Specialization:    

  • Specialization: Pharmaceutics
  • Areas of Interest: Pharmaceutical Formulation development, Ethnomedicine, and their evaluation, Natural Pharmaceuticals

 

Patent: Granted 05

 

Consultancy/Technology Transfer:

  • Consultancy service/Technology transfer to M/S Celsius Healthcare Pvt. Ltd., Ghaziabad (U.P.), 2020 on Taste Masking of Bitter Drugs
